Merge tag 'efm32-for-4.4-rc1' of git://git.pengutronix.de/git/ukl/linux into next/cleanup
Merge "efm32 cleanups for 4.4-rc1" from Uwe Kleine-Koenig:
These are just two followup cleanups for commits that are in v3.17-rc1 and
waited in my private tree for application since that time.
* tag 'efm32-for-4.4-rc1' of git://git.pengutronix.de/git/ukl/linux:
ARM: efm32: switch to vendor,device compatible strings
ARM: efm32: switch to properly namespaced location property
